/*
 * Secure boot is the process by which NVIDIA-signed firmware is loaded into
 * some of the falcons of a GPU. For production devices this is the only way
 * for the firmware to access useful (but sensitive) registers.
 *
 * A Falcon microprocessor supporting advanced security modes can run in one of
 * three modes:
 *
 * - Non-secure (NS). In this mode, functionality is similar to Falcon
 *   architectures before security modes were introduced (pre-Maxwell), but
 *   capability is restricted. In particular, certain registers may be
 *   inaccessible for reads and/or writes, and physical memory access may be
 *   disabled (on certain Falcon instances). This is the only possible mode that
 *   can be used if you don't have microcode cryptographically signed by NVIDIA.
 *
 * - Heavy Secure (HS). In this mode, the microprocessor is a black box - it's
 *   not possible to read or write any Falcon internal state or Falcon registers
 *   from outside the Falcon (for example, from the host system). The only way
 *   to enable this mode is by loading microcode that has been signed by NVIDIA.
 *   (The loading process involves tagging the IMEM block as secure, writing the
 *   signature into a Falcon register, and starting execution. The hardware will
 *   validate the signature, and if valid, grant HS privileges.)
 *
 * - Light Secure (LS). In this mode, the microprocessor has more privileges
 *   than NS but fewer than HS. Some of the microprocessor state is visible to
 *   host software to ease debugging. The only way to enable this mode is by HS
 *   microcode enabling LS mode. Some privileges available to HS mode are not
 *   available here. LS mode is introduced in GM20x.
 *
 * Secure boot consists in temporarily switching a HS-capable falcon (typically
 * PMU) into HS mode in order to validate the LS firmwares of managed falcons,
 * load them, and switch managed falcons into LS mode. Once secure boot
 * completes, no falcon remains in HS mode.
 *
 * Secure boot requires a write-protected memory region (WPR) which can only be
 * written by the secure falcon. On dGPU, the driver sets up the WPR region in
 * video memory. On Tegra, it is set up by the bootloader and its location and
 * size written into memory controller registers.
 *
 * The secure boot process takes place as follows:
 *
 * 1) A LS blob is constructed that contains all the LS firmwares we want to
 *    load, along with their signatures and bootloaders.
 *
 * 2) A HS blob (also called ACR) is created that contains the signed HS
 *    firmware in charge of loading the LS firmwares into their respective
 *    falcons.
 *
 * 3) The HS blob is loaded (via its own bootloader) and executed on the
 *    HS-capable falcon. It authenticates itself, switches the secure falcon to
 *    HS mode and setup the WPR region around the LS blob (dGPU) or copies the
 *    LS blob into the WPR region (Tegra).
 *
 * 4) The LS blob is now secure from all external tampering. The HS falcon
 *    checks the signatures of the LS firmwares and, if valid, switches the
 *    managed falcons to LS mode and makes them ready to run the LS firmware.
 *
 * 5) The managed falcons remain in LS mode and can be started.
 *
 */

/**
 * struct fw_bin_header - header of firmware files
 * @bin_magic:          always 0x3b1d14f0
 * @bin_ver:            version of the bin format
 * @bin_size:           entire image size including this header
 * @header_offset:      offset of the firmware/bootloader header in the file
 * @data_offset:        offset of the firmware/bootloader payload in the file
 * @data_size:          size of the payload
 *
 * This header is located at the beginning of the HS firmware and HS bootloader
 * files, to describe where the headers and data can be found.
 */
struct fw_bin_header {
	
u32 bin_magic;
	
u32 bin_ver;
	
u32 bin_size;
	
u32 header_offset;
	
u32 data_offset;
	
u32 data_size;
};
/**
 * struct fw_bl_desc - firmware bootloader descriptor
 * @start_tag:          starting tag of bootloader
 * @desc_dmem_load_off: DMEM offset of flcn_bl_dmem_desc
 * @code_off:           offset of code section
 * @code_size:          size of code section
 * @data_off:           offset of data section
 * @data_size:          size of data section
 *
 * This structure is embedded in bootloader firmware files at to describe the
 * IMEM and DMEM layout expected by the bootloader.
 */
struct fw_bl_desc {
	
u32 start_tag;
	
u32 dmem_load_off;
	
u32 code_off;
	
u32 code_size;
	
u32 data_off;
	
u32 data_size;
};
/*
 *
 * LS blob structures
 *
 */
/**
 * struct lsf_ucode_desc - LS falcon signatures
 * @prd_keys:           signature to use when the GPU is in production mode
 * @dgb_keys:           signature to use when the GPU is in debug mode
 * @b_prd_present:      whether the production key is present
 * @b_dgb_present:      whether the debug key is present
 * @falcon_id:          ID of the falcon the ucode applies to
 *
 * Directly loaded from a signature file.
 */
struct lsf_ucode_desc {
	
u8  prd_keys[2][16];
	
u8  dbg_keys[2][16];
	
u32 b_prd_present;
	
u32 b_dbg_present;
	
u32 falcon_id;
};
/**
 * struct lsf_lsb_header - LS firmware header
 * @signature:          signature to verify the firmware against
 * @ucode_off:          offset of the ucode blob in the WPR region. The ucode
 *                      blob contains the bootloader, code and data of the
 *                      LS falcon
 * @ucode_size:         size of the ucode blob, including bootloader
 * @data_size:          size of the ucode blob data
 * @bl_code_size:       size of the bootloader code
 * @bl_imem_off:        offset in imem of the bootloader
 * @bl_data_off:        offset of the bootloader data in WPR region
 * @bl_data_size:       size of the bootloader data
 * @app_code_off:       offset of the app code relative to ucode_off
 * @app_code_size:      size of the app code
 * @app_data_off:       offset of the app data relative to ucode_off
 * @app_data_size:      size of the app data
 * @flags:              flags for the secure bootloader
 *
 * This structure is written into the WPR region for each managed falcon. Each
 * instance is referenced by the lsb_offset member of the corresponding
 * lsf_wpr_header.
 */
struct lsf_lsb_header {
	
struct lsf_ucode_desc signature;
	
u32 ucode_off;
	
u32 ucode_size;
	
u32 data_size;
	
u32 bl_code_size;
	
u32 bl_imem_off;
	
u32 bl_data_off;
	
u32 bl_data_size;
	
u32 app_code_off;
	
u32 app_code_size;
	
u32 app_data_off;
	
u32 app_data_size;
	
u32 flags;
#define LSF_FLAG_LOAD_CODE_AT_0		1
#define LSF_FLAG_DMACTL_REQ_CTX		4
#define LSF_FLAG_FORCE_PRIV_LOAD	8
};
/**
 * struct lsf_wpr_header - LS blob WPR Header
 * @falcon_id:          LS falcon ID
 * @lsb_offset:         offset of the lsb_lsf_header in the WPR region
 * @bootstrap_owner:    secure falcon reponsible for bootstrapping the LS falcon
 * @lazy_bootstrap:     skip bootstrapping by ACR
 * @status:             bootstrapping status
 *
 * An array of these is written at the beginning of the WPR region, one for
 * each managed falcon. The array is terminated by an instance which falcon_id
 * is LSF_FALCON_ID_INVALID.
 */
struct lsf_wpr_header {
	
u32  falcon_id;
	
u32  lsb_offset;
	
u32  bootstrap_owner;
	
u32  lazy_bootstrap;
	
u32  status;
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_NONE				0
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_COPY				1
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_VALIDATION_CODE_FAILED		2
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_VALIDATION_DATA_FAILED		3
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_VALIDATION_DONE		4
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_VALIDATION_SKIPPED		5
#define L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_BOOTSTRAP_READY		6
};
/**
 * struct ls_ucode_img_desc - descriptor of firmware image
 * @descriptor_size:            size of this descriptor
 * @image_size:                 size of the whole image
 * @bootloader_start_offset:    start offset of the bootloader in ucode image
 * @bootloader_size:            size of the bootloader
 * @bootloader_imem_offset:     start off set of the bootloader in IMEM
 * @bootloader_entry_point:     entry point of the bootloader in IMEM
 * @app_start_offset:           start offset of the LS firmware
 * @app_size:                   size of the LS firmware's code and data
 * @app_imem_offset:            offset of the app in IMEM
 * @app_imem_entry:             entry point of the app in IMEM
 * @app_dmem_offset:            offset of the data in DMEM
 * @app_resident_code_offset:   offset of app code from app_start_offset
 * @app_resident_code_size:     size of the code
 * @app_resident_data_offset:   offset of data from app_start_offset
 * @app_resident_data_size:     size of data
 *
 * A firmware image contains the code, data, and bootloader of a given LS
 * falcon in a single blob. This structure describes where everything is.
 *
 * This can be generated from a (bootloader, code, data) set if they have
 * been loaded separately, or come directly from a file.
 */
struct ls_ucode_img_desc {
	
u32 descriptor_size;
	
u32 image_size;
	
u32 tools_version;
	
u32 app_version;
	
char date[64];
	
u32 bootloader_start_offset;
	
u32 bootloader_size;
	
u32 bootloader_imem_offset;
	
u32 bootloader_entry_point;
	
u32 app_start_offset;
	
u32 app_size;
	
u32 app_imem_offset;
	
u32 app_imem_entry;
	
u32 app_dmem_offset;
	
u32 app_resident_code_offset;
	
u32 app_resident_code_size;
	
u32 app_resident_data_offset;
	
u32 app_resident_data_size;
	
u32 nb_overlays;
	
struct {u32 start; u32 size; } load_ovl[64];
	
u32 compressed;
};
/**
 * struct ls_ucode_img - temporary storage for loaded LS firmwares
 * @node:               to link within lsf_ucode_mgr
 * @falcon_id:          ID of the falcon this LS firmware is for
 * @ucode_desc:         loaded or generated map of ucode_data
 * @ucode_header:       header of the firmware
 * @ucode_data:         firmware payload (code and data)
 * @ucode_size:         size in bytes of data in ucode_data
 * @wpr_header:         WPR header to be written to the LS blob
 * @lsb_header:         LSB header to be written to the LS blob
 *
 * Preparing the WPR LS blob requires information about all the LS firmwares
 * (size, etc) to be known. This structure contains all the data of one LS
 * firmware.
 */
struct ls_ucode_img {
	
struct list_head node;
	
enum nvkm_secboot_falcon falcon_id;
	
struct ls_ucode_img_desc ucode_desc;
	
u32 *ucode_header;
	
u8 *ucode_data;
	
u32 ucode_size;
	
struct lsf_wpr_header wpr_header;
	
struct lsf_lsb_header lsb_header;
};
/**
 * struct ls_ucode_mgr - manager for all LS falcon firmwares
 * @count:      number of managed LS falcons
 * @wpr_size:   size of the required WPR region in bytes
 * @img_list:   linked list of lsf_ucode_img
 */
struct ls_ucode_mgr {
	
u16 count;
	
u32 wpr_size;
	
struct list_head img_list;
};
/*
 *
 * HS blob structures
 *
 */
/**
 * struct hsf_fw_header - HS firmware descriptor
 * @sig_dbg_offset:     offset of the debug signature
 * @sig_dbg_size:       size of the debug signature
 * @sig_prod_offset:    offset of the production signature
 * @sig_prod_size:      size of the production signature
 * @patch_loc:          offset of the offset (sic) of where the signature is
 * @patch_sig:          offset of the offset (sic) to add to sig_*_offset
 * @hdr_offset:         offset of the load header (see struct hs_load_header)
 * @hdr_size:           size of above header
 *
 * This structure is embedded in the HS firmware image at
 * hs_bin_hdr.header_offset.
 */
struct hsf_fw_header {
	
u32 sig_dbg_offset;
	
u32 sig_dbg_size;
	
u32 sig_prod_offset;
	
u32 sig_prod_size;
	
u32 patch_loc;
	
u32 patch_sig;
	
u32 hdr_offset;
	
u32 hdr_size;
};
/**
 * struct hsf_load_header - HS firmware load header
 */
struct hsf_load_header {
	
u32 non_sec_code_off;
	
u32 non_sec_code_size;
	
u32 data_dma_base;
	
u32 data_size;
	
u32 num_apps;
	struct {
		
u32 sec_code_off;
		
u32 sec_code_size;
	} 
app[0];
};
/**
 * Convenience function to duplicate a firmware file in memory and check that
 * it has the required minimum size.
 */
static void *
gm200_secboot_load_firmware(struct nvkm_subdev *subdev, const char *name,
		    size_t min_size)
{
	const struct firmware *fw;
	void *blob;
	int ret;
	ret = nvkm_firmware_get(subdev->device, name, &fw);
	if (ret)
		return ERR_PTR(ret);
	if (fw->size < min_size) {
		nvkm_error(subdev, "%s is smaller than expected size %zu\n",
			   name, min_size);
		nvkm_firmware_put(fw);
		return ERR_PTR(-EINVAL);
	}
	blob = kmemdup(fw->data, fw->size, GFP_KERNEL);
	nvkm_firmware_put(fw);
	if (!blob)
		return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
	return blob;
}

/*
 * Low-secure blob creation
 */
#define B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E 256
/**
 * Build a ucode image and descriptor from provided bootloader, code and data.
 *
 * @bl:         bootloader image, including 16-bytes descriptor
 * @code:       LS firmware code segment
 * @data:       LS firmware data segment
 * @desc:       ucode descriptor to be written
 *
 * Return: allocated ucode image with corresponding descriptor information. desc
 *         is also updated to contain the right offsets within returned image.
 */
static void *
ls_ucode_img_build(const struct firmware *bl, const struct firmware *code,
		   const struct firmware *data, struct ls_ucode_img_desc *desc)
{
	struct fw_bin_header *bin_hdr = (void *)bl->data;
	struct fw_bl_desc *bl_desc = (void *)bl->data + bin_hdr->header_offset;
	void *bl_data = (void *)bl->data + bin_hdr->data_offset;
	u32 pos = 0;
	void *image;
	desc->bootloader_start_offset = pos;
	desc->bootloader_size = ALIGN(bl_desc->code_size, sizeof(u32));
	desc->bootloader_imem_offset = bl_desc->start_tag * 256;
	desc->bootloader_entry_point = bl_desc->start_tag * 256;
	pos = ALIGN(pos + desc->bootloader_size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E);
	desc->app_start_offset = pos;
	desc->app_size = ALIGN(code->size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E) +
			 ALIGN(data->size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E);
	desc->app_imem_offset = 0;
	desc->app_imem_entry = 0;
	desc->app_dmem_offset = 0;
	desc->app_resident_code_offset = 0;
	desc->app_resident_code_size = ALIGN(code->size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E);
	pos = ALIGN(pos + desc->app_resident_code_size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E);
	desc->app_resident_data_offset = pos - desc->app_start_offset;
	desc->app_resident_data_size = ALIGN(data->size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E);
	desc->image_size = ALIGN(bl_desc->code_size, BL_DESC_BLK_SIZE) +
			   desc->app_size;
	image = kzalloc(desc->image_size, GFP_KERNEL);
	if (!image)
		return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
	memcpy(image + desc->bootloader_start_offset, bl_data,
	       bl_desc->code_size);
	memcpy(image + desc->app_start_offset, code->data, code->size);
	memcpy(image + desc->app_start_offset + desc->app_resident_data_offset,
	       data->data, data->size);
	return image;
}

#define LSF_LSB_HEADER_ALIGN 256
#define LSF_BL_DATA_ALIGN 256
#define LSF_BL_DATA_SIZE_ALIGN 256
#define LSF_BL_CODE_SIZE_ALIGN 256
#define LSF_UCODE_DATA_ALIGN 4096
/**
 * ls_ucode_img_fill_headers - fill the WPR and LSB headers of an image
 * @gsb:        secure boot device used
 * @img:        image to generate for
 * @offset:     offset in the WPR region where this image starts
 *
 * Allocate space in the WPR area from offset and write the WPR and LSB headers
 * accordingly.
 *
 * Return: offset at the end of this image.
 */
static u32
ls_ucode_img_fill_headers(struct gm200_secboot *gsb, struct ls_ucode_img *img,
			  u32 offset)
{
	struct lsf_wpr_header *whdr = &img->wpr_header;
	struct lsf_lsb_header *lhdr = &img->lsb_header;
	struct ls_ucode_img_desc *desc = &img->ucode_desc;
	if (img->ucode_header) {
		nvkm_fatal(&gsb->base.subdev,
			    "images withough loader are not supported yet!\n");
		return offset;
	}
	/* Fill WPR header */
	whdr->falcon_id = img->falcon_id;
	whdr->bootstrap_owner = gsb->base.func->boot_falcon;
	whdr->status = LSF_IMAGE_STATUS_COPY;
	/* Align, save off, and include an LSB header size */
	offset = ALIGN(offset, LSF_LSB_HEADER_ALIGN);
	whdr->lsb_offset = offset;
	offset += sizeof(struct lsf_lsb_header);
	/*
         * Align, save off, and include the original (static) ucode
         * image size
         */
	offset = ALIGN(offset, LSF_UCODE_DATA_ALIGN);
	lhdr->ucode_off = offset;
	offset += img->ucode_size;
	/*
         * For falcons that use a boot loader (BL), we append a loader
         * desc structure on the end of the ucode image and consider
         * this the boot loader data. The host will then copy the loader
         * desc args to this space within the WPR region (before locking
         * down) and the HS bin will then copy them to DMEM 0 for the
         * loader.
         */
	lhdr->bl_code_size = ALIGN(desc->bootloader_size,
				   LSF_BL_CODE_SIZE_ALIGN);
	lhdr->ucode_size = ALIGN(desc->app_resident_data_offset,
				 LSF_BL_CODE_SIZE_ALIGN) + lhdr->bl_code_size;
	lhdr->data_size = ALIGN(desc->app_size, LSF_BL_CODE_SIZE_ALIGN) +
				lhdr->bl_code_size - lhdr->ucode_size;
	/*
         * Though the BL is located at 0th offset of the image, the VA
         * is different to make sure that it doesn't collide the actual
         * OS VA range
         */
	lhdr->bl_imem_off = desc->bootloader_imem_offset;
	lhdr->app_code_off = desc->app_start_offset +
			     desc->app_resident_code_offset;
	lhdr->app_code_size = desc->app_resident_code_size;
	lhdr->app_data_off = desc->app_start_offset +
			     desc->app_resident_data_offset;
	lhdr->app_data_size = desc->app_resident_data_size;
	lhdr->flags = 0;
	if (img->falcon_id == gsb->base.func->boot_falcon)
		lhdr->flags = LSF_FLAG_DMACTL_REQ_CTX;
	/* GPCCS will be loaded using PRI */
	if (img->falcon_id == NVKM_SECBOOT_FALCON_GPCCS)
		lhdr->flags |= LSF_FLAG_FORCE_PRIV_LOAD;
	/* Align (size bloat) and save off BL descriptor size */
	lhdr->bl_data_size = ALIGN(sizeof(struct gm200_flcn_bl_desc),
				   LSF_BL_DATA_SIZE_ALIGN);
	/*
         * Align, save off, and include the additional BL data
         */
	offset = ALIGN(offset, LSF_BL_DATA_ALIGN);
	lhdr->bl_data_off = offset;
	offset += lhdr->bl_data_size;
	return offset;
}

/**
 * ls_ucode_mgr_fill_headers - fill WPR and LSB headers of all managed images
 */
static void
ls_ucode_mgr_fill_headers(struct gm200_secboot *gsb, struct ls_ucode_mgr *mgr)
{
	struct ls_ucode_img *img;
	u32 offset;
	/*
         * Start with an array of WPR headers at the base of the WPR.
         * The expectation here is that the secure falcon will do a single DMA
         * read of this array and cache it internally so it's ok to pack these.
         * Also, we add 1 to the falcon count to indicate the end of the array.
         */
	offset = sizeof(struct lsf_wpr_header) * (mgr->count + 1);
	/*
         * Walk the managed falcons, accounting for the LSB structs
         * as well as the ucode images.
         */
	list_for_each_entry(img, &mgr->img_list, node) {
		offset = ls_ucode_img_fill_headers(gsb, img, offset);
	}
	mgr->wpr_size = offset;
}

/*
 * Secure Boot Execution
 */
/**
 * gm200_secboot_load_hs_bl() - load HS bootloader into DMEM and IMEM
 */
static void
gm200_secboot_load_hs_bl(struct gm200_secboot *gsb, void *data, u32 data_size)
{
	struct nvkm_device *device = gsb->base.subdev.device;
	struct fw_bin_header *hdr = gsb->hsbl_blob;
	struct fw_bl_desc *hsbl_desc = gsb->hsbl_blob + hdr->header_offset;
	void *blob_data = gsb->hsbl_blob + hdr->data_offset;
	void *hsbl_code = blob_data + hsbl_desc->code_off;
	void *hsbl_data = blob_data + hsbl_desc->data_off;
	u32 code_size = ALIGN(hsbl_desc->code_size, 256);
	const u32 base = gsb->base.base;
	u32 blk;
	u32 tag;
	int i;
	/*
         * Copy HS bootloader data
         */
	n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x1c0, (0x00000000 | (0x1 << 24)));
	for (i = 0; i < hsbl_desc->data_size / 4; i++)
		n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x1c4, ((u32 *)hsbl_data)[i]);
	/*
         * Copy HS bootloader interface structure where the HS descriptor
         * expects it to be
         */
	n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x1c0,
		  (hsbl_desc->dmem_load_off | (0x1 << 24)));
	for (i = 0; i < data_size / 4; i++)
		n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x1c4, ((u32 *)data)[i]);
	/* Copy HS bootloader code to end of IMEM */
	blk = (nvkm_rd32(device, base + 0x108) & 0x1ff) - (code_size >> 8);
	tag = hsbl_desc->start_tag;
	n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x180, ((blk & 0xff) << 8) | (0x1 << 24));
	for (i = 0; i < code_size / 4; i++) {
		/* write new tag every 256B */
		if ((i & 0x3f) == 0) {
			n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x188, tag & 0xffff);
			tag++;
		}
		n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x184, ((u32 *)hsbl_code)[i]);
	}
	nvkm_wr32(device, base + 0x188, 0);
}
